There have been changes to the way funeral services are organised over the years and Stephen and Glenys are finding more frequently that families want to play a greater role in the organisation of services for their loved ones.

Technology has also played a role in the changing face of funeral services with videos or podcasts becoming more common to be played during services.  The idea of ‘celebrating’ the life of the deceased has meant families are opting for more upbeat services compared to what was traditionally a very sombre event.  There are many more options available now to create a truly bespoke service and Tester & Jones are able to source almost anything that is required and very happy to work with customers who are looking to go down a more unconventional route.

One of the big changes the industry has seen over recent years is the introduction of Funeral Plans, whereby you can pay and plan your funeral in advance.  Over the next 10 years it is estimated that over 50% of funerals will be pre-planned.  This means you can organise your funeral at today’s prices which gives you peace of mind as prices are always rising.  Did you know the average price today for a funeral is £3.5k?  It’s no wonder pre-planned funerals are growing in popularity.
